2 Dead After Wrong-Way Driver Crash On Interstate 43: Reports

A wrong-way driver led to a crash on I-43 near South Chase Avenue early Wednesday morning and two people are dead, according to reports.

MILWAUKEE, WI — A wrong-way driver crashed on Interstate 43 south early Wednesday morning near South Chase Avenue in Milwaukee, injuring two people who have since died, according to multiple media reports.

The Milwaukee County Sheriff's Office announced a closure for the southbound lanes around 2 a.m., with traffic being diverted off at Becher Street, a tweet from the office said. Two people were seriously injured in the crash and brought to a hospital where they died, according to a report by TMJ4 News.

Traffic information from the Wisconsin Department of Transportation and reports say the highway has since been re-opened.
